Kali LinuxのUSBブートは、USBメモリを利用してオペレーティングシステムを起動する便利な方法です。このプロセスを通じて、ユーザーは簡単にKali Linuxをインストールしたり、ライブ環境で使用することができます。さらに、セキュリティ設定を適切に行うことで、システムの安全性を高めることが可能です。

Kali LinuxのUSBブートとは何ですか?
Kali LinuxのUSBブートは、USBメモリを使用してKali Linuxを起動する方法です。このプロセスにより、ユーザーはオペレーティングシステムを簡単にインストールしたり、ライブ環境で使用したりできます。
USBブートの定義と目的
USBブートとは、コンピュータがUSBデバイスからオペレーティングシステムを起動するプロセスです。Kali LinuxをUSBからブートする目的は、持ち運び可能なセキュリティツールとしての利用や、システムの診断、ペネトレーションテストを行うことです。
Kali LinuxのUSBブートの利点
Kali LinuxをUSBからブートすることには多くの利点があります。まず、インストールなしでシステムを試すことができ、必要に応じてデータを保存することも可能です。また、USBメモリは軽量で持ち運びが簡単なため、どこでもKali Linuxを利用できます。
USBブートの必要なハードウェア
Kali LinuxのUSBブートには、基本的にUSBメモリとブート可能なコンピュータが必要です。USBメモリは、少なくとも8GBの容量が推奨されます。さらに、BIOSまたはUEFI設定でUSBブートを有効にする必要があります。
USBブートの一般的な使用例
Kali LinuxのUSBブートは、セキュリティテストやネットワーク診断に広く使用されています。例えば、企業のネットワークの脆弱性を評価するために、Kali LinuxをUSBから起動してツールを使用することができます。また、システムの復旧やデータのバックアップにも利用されます。

どのようにKali LinuxをUSBからブートしますか?
Kali LinuxをUSBからブートするには、適切なUSBドライブを準備し、ブート可能なUSBを作成し、BIOS設定を調整する必要があります。これにより、Kali Linuxを直接USBから起動し、セキュリティテストやシステム管理を行うことができます。
USBドライブの準備手順
まず、Kali LinuxをインストールするためのUSBドライブを選びます。通常、8GB以上の容量を持つUSBドライブが推奨されます。データが保存されている場合は、バックアップを取ってからフォーマットを行います。
次に、USBドライブをコンピュータに接続し、フォーマットします。Windowsでは「ディスクの管理」を使用し、macOSでは「ディスクユーティリティ」を利用して、FAT32形式でフォーマットすることが一般的です。
ブート可能なUSBの作成方法
ブート可能なUSBを作成するには、RufusやEtcherなどのツールを使用します。これらのツールは、ISOイメージをUSBドライブに書き込む機能を提供します。Kali Linuxの公式サイトからISOファイルをダウンロードし、選択したツールでUSBに書き込む手順を進めます。
書き込みが完了したら、USBドライブを安全に取り外します。これで、Kali LinuxをUSBからブートする準備が整いました。
BIOS設定の変更手順
USBからブートするためには、BIOS設定を変更する必要があります。コンピュータを再起動し、起動時に指定されたキー(通常はF2、F10、DELなど)を押してBIOS設定に入ります。
BIOSメニュー内で「Boot」タブを選択し、USBドライブを最初のブートデバイスとして設定します。設定を保存してBIOSを終了すると、次回の起動時にUSBからブートすることができます。
USBからのブートのトラブルシューティング
USBからブートできない場合、まずUSBドライブが正しく作成されているか確認します。RufusやEtcherでの書き込み時にエラーがなかったか再確認してください。
次に、BIOS設定が正しく行われているかをチェックします。USBドライブが最初のブートデバイスとして設定されていることを確認し、必要に応じて設定を再調整します。
最後に、USBポートやドライブ自体に問題がないかも確認します。別のUSBポートや他のコンピュータで試すことで、問題の特定が可能です。

Kali Linuxのセキュリティ設定はどのように行いますか?
Kali Linuxのセキュリティ設定は、システムを安全に保つために重要です。初期設定からファイアウォールの構成、ユーザー管理、定期的なセキュリティ更新まで、さまざまな手順を踏む必要があります。
初期設定でのセキュリティ強化
Kali Linuxをインストールした後、最初に行うべきは初期設定のセキュリティ強化です。デフォルトのパスワードを変更し、不要なサービスを無効化することが基本です。
具体的には、SSHやFTPなどのリモートアクセスサービスを必要に応じて無効にし、ファイアウォールを有効にして外部からのアクセスを制限します。また、システムのユーザーアカウントを見直し、必要な権限のみを付与することも重要です。
ファイアウォールの設定方法
Kali Linuxでは、iptablesやufw(Uncomplicated Firewall)を使用してファイアウォールを設定できます。これにより、特定のポートへのアクセスを制限し、不要なトラフィックをブロックできます。
例えば、ufwを使用する場合、以下のコマンドでファイアウォールを有効にし、特定のポートを開放できます。
- ufw enable – ファイアウォールを有効化
- ufw allow 22 – SSHポートを開放
設定後は、ufw statusコマンドで現在のルールを確認し、適切に設定されているかをチェックします。
ユーザーアカウントと権限の管理
ユーザーアカウントの管理は、Kali Linuxのセキュリティにおいて重要な要素です。不要なユーザーアカウントを削除し、必要なアカウントには適切な権限を設定することが求められます。
特に、管理者権限を持つユーザーは最小限にし、一般ユーザーには必要な権限のみを与えるようにしましょう。これにより、万が一アカウントが侵害された場合のリスクを軽減できます。
セキュリティ更新の適用方法
Kali Linuxのセキュリティ更新は、システムを最新の状態に保つために欠かせません。定期的にパッケージを更新し、脆弱性を修正することが重要です。
更新は、apt updateおよびapt upgradeコマンドを使用して行います。これにより、最新のセキュリティパッチが適用され、システムの安全性が向上します。
また、定期的に自動更新を設定することで、手動での確認を省略し、常に最新の状態を維持することが可能です。

Kali Linuxの専門的な手順は何ですか?
Kali Linuxの専門的な手順は、セキュリティテストやペネトレーションテストを効率的に実施するための具体的な方法や技術を指します。これには高度なネットワーク設定、ペネトレーションテストの実施、ツールのインストールと設定、ログ管理と監視のベストプラクティスが含まれます。
高度なネットワーク設定手順
高度なネットワーク設定は、Kali Linuxを効果的に活用するために不可欠です。まず、ネットワークインターフェースの設定を確認し、必要に応じて静的IPアドレスを割り当てることが重要です。
次に、VPNやプロキシを使用してトラフィックを暗号化し、匿名性を確保します。これにより、テスト中のデータの漏洩を防ぐことができます。
ペネトレーションテストの実施手順
ペネトレーションテストを実施する際は、まずテストの範囲を明確に定義し、対象システムの情報収集を行います。これには、ネットワークスキャンや脆弱性スキャンが含まれます。
次に、特定された脆弱性を利用して侵入を試み、システムのセキュリティを評価します。テスト後は、発見した脆弱性に基づいて詳細なレポートを作成し、改善策を提案します。
ツールのインストールと設定
Kali Linuxには多くのセキュリティツールがプリインストールされていますが、必要に応じて追加のツールをインストールすることもあります。例えば、MetasploitやBurp Suiteなどのツールは、ペネトレーションテストに非常に役立ちます。
ツールをインストールしたら、各ツールの設定を行い、特定のニーズに合わせてカスタマイズします。設定ファイルを適切に管理し、定期的にアップデートすることが重要です。
ログ管理と監視のベストプラクティス
ログ管理と監視は、Kali Linuxを使用する上での重要な要素です。システムのログを定期的に確認し、不審な活動を早期に発見するための監視体制を整えます。
また、ログの保存期間を設定し、必要に応じて外部ストレージにバックアップを取ることが推奨されます。これにより、後の分析やトラブルシューティングが容易になります。

Kali LinuxのUSBブートに関する一般的な問題は何ですか?
Kali LinuxのUSBブートに関する一般的な問題には、USBデバイスの認識失敗やブート順序の設定ミスが含まれます。これらの問題は、正しい手順を踏むことで解決可能です。
USBブートが機能しない理由
USBブートが機能しない主な理由には、BIOS設定の不備やUSBデバイス自体の問題があります。特に、ブート順序が正しく設定されていないと、システムはUSBから起動しません。
また、USBドライブが正しくフォーマットされていない場合や、Kali Linuxのイメージが正しく書き込まれていないことも原因となります。これらの問題を避けるためには、RufusやEtcherなどの信頼できるツールを使用して、ISOイメージをUSBに書き込むことが重要です。
最後に、USBポートの不具合やハードウェアの互換性も考慮する必要があります。異なるポートや別のUSBデバイスを試すことで、問題の特定が可能です。

